Transaction 8575d704f22df1b5bf42852ec08e2788e3d2afcb247829e0b8df5846cfd0a5bf

3 Input
2 Outputs
  • 8575d704f22df1b5bf42852ec08e2788e3d2afcb247829e0b8df5846cfd0a5bf:0
  • value  56542108
    address  116F8RtWPduPFD2Xcf5n2mPjhTvtZjH8wf
  • 8575d704f22df1b5bf42852ec08e2788e3d2afcb247829e0b8df5846cfd0a5bf:1
  • value  300000000
    address  3MPPxHN64cATC5J7FxQ3zA5vtzVmfejpR7